(f+g)(x) is shorthand notation for f(x)+g(x). So (f+g)(x) means that you add the functions f and g (f-g)(x) simply means f(x)-g(x). So in this case, you subtract the functions. (f*g)(x)=f(x)*g(x). So this time you are multiplying the functions and finally, (f/g)(x)=f(x)/g(x). Now …

Let f(x) = 2x + 1 and g(x) = x^2 - 4 (fg)(x) has two meanings whether it is component wise multiplication or composition if it is multiplication then (fg)(x) = f(x)*g(x) and if it is composition then (fg)(x) = f(g(x)). There are condition underwhich each of the above is valid I am assuming it is multiplication here
